Higher Order Linear Stability and Instability of Reissner-Nordstr\"om's Cauchy Horizon
Abstract
We consider smooth solutions of the wave equation, on a fixed black hole region of a subextremal Reissner-Nordstr\"om (asymptotically flat, de Sitter or anti-de Sitter) spacetime, whose restrictions to the event horizon have compact support. We provide criteria, in terms of surface gravities, for the waves to remain in $C^l$, $l\geq 1$, up to and including the Cauchy horizon. We also provide sufficient conditions for the blow up of solutions in $C^1$ and $H^1$.
